New Pathways Youth Services, Inc is in search of a Clinical Supervisor to provide oversight for our agency. We provide Mental Health Skill Building and Intensive In-Home services to adults and children within the Greater Richmond Area. As the Clinical Supervisor, you will work side by side with our Chief of Operations to ensure quality service is provided to our clients, conduct Weekly supervisions, review documentation, and complete biopsychosocial assessments. Our Purpose
To help solve problems within the context of families rather than through placement outside the home. Services are based on the tenant that the family is the most powerful social institution and that families should be supported and maintained whenever possible. NPYS seeks to develop, support, and empower the family unit by teaching problem solving skills, assisting parents in becoming advocates for themselves, and coordinating available community resources. New Pathways brings services into the home and develop a comprehensive treatment plan to address the family’s practical and material difficulties together with their psychological or mental health treatment needs.
